1.反叛的;有反叛倾向的
If someone ismutinous, they are strongly dissatisfied with a person in authority and are likely to stop obeying them.
e.g. His own army, stung by defeats, ismutinous.
经历失败的痛楚后,他所率军队出现反叛情绪。
